6RECORDING FUNCTION

6.1Activex control recording

ActiveX control recording function is for IE browser only, and can not for Netscape Navigator browser.

Please right-click the mouse at the image and select the recording setting in the option box appeared when browsing.

[File path]: select the folder in which JPEG files saved.

[File name]: enter the file mark. Actual recorder file is name(file+date+time) [interval]

6.3Playback function

The image can be played by free media-playback tool provided by our company or ACDSee.

Open the media-playback tool, open the selected file, and play the file. The function of delay is adjustable and the function of circle is selectable. The date and time should be the same as PC.
